LASER-ULTRASOUND THERAPY IN THE COMPREHENSIVE TREATMENT OF CHRONIC OBSTRUCTIVE PULMONARY DISEASE
https://doi.org/10.21292/2075-1230-2018-96-8-31-36
Abstract
The objective of the study: to investigate the efficiency of treatment of those suffering from chronic obstructive pulmonary disease (COPD) when using laser-ultrasound effect along with traditional therapy.
Subjects and methods. 58 COPD patients were enrolled into the study. The article describes the number of clinical, laboratory and functional rates, parameters of external respiration functions, biomarkers of system inflammation during treatment including the low-intensity laser radiation, exposure to ultrasound and basic medicamentous therapy.
Results. The laser ultrasound therapy as a part of comprehensive treatment of COPD patients allows achieving the maximum effect for the following criteria: excretion of sputum (the amount of sputum produced during 24 hours), the subjective assessment of cough and sputum by visual analogue scale; improvement of peripheral blood rates, reduction of system biomarkers (IL-4, IL-8, TNF-2), improvement of external respiration function and general state of the patients.
